Begumisa and others v Tibebaga (Civil Appeal 17 of 2003)

Citation: [2004] UGSC 46 Court: Supreme Court Decided: 22 June 2004 Jurisdiction: Uganda

A certificate of title is conclusive only of the particulars set forth in it; the respondent's title did not relate to the suit land, so his suit failed.
